Foundation for Artificial Intelligence-Driven Democratization of Healthcare Access
1School of Public Health and Social Work Queensland University of Technology Brisbane Australia.
Introduction:
Healthcare systems worldwide face unprecedented challenges, including escalating costs, workforce shortages, and access disparities, which threaten their sustainability. The WHO projects an 18 million healthcare worker deficit by 2030, while financial and geographical barriers prevent millions from receiving necessary care. The integration of Artificial Intelligence (AI) into healthcare delivery systems presents opportunities to transform medical service provision, accessibility, and experiences, potentially democratizing healthcare access.
Methods:
This perspective analysis employs a theoretical framework combining Levesque et al.'s patient-centered healthcare access model with AI democratization frameworks. The analysis synthesizes current evidence on AI healthcare applications and proposes an implementation framework encompassing four dimensions: accessibility, affordability, usability, and ethical regulation. The framework addresses stakeholder roles and governance mechanisms aligned with international standards including the EU's AI Act and WHO's AI ethics guidance.
Results:
Evidence demonstrates significant democratization potential through the implementation of AI. AI-powered platforms eliminate geographical barriers, reduce diagnostic timeframes, optimize resources, and enhance preventive care. Implementation challenges include algorithmic bias, data privacy concerns, digital divide risks, and regulatory fragmentation.
Conclusion:
AI integration holds transformative potential for democratizing healthcare across demographic and socioeconomic boundaries. Successful implementation requires structured, ethically grounded approaches that prioritize accessibility, affordability, usability, and regulation while maintaining a human-centered care approach. The framework offers actionable guidance for healthcare professionals and policymakers on deploying AI technologies to reduce disparities. Continuous research, interdisciplinary collaboration, and robust governance are crucial to ensuring that AI advances healthcare equity while preserving patient autonomy and clinical judgment.
Patient Or Public Contribution:
Patient and Public Involvement and Engagement was not appropriate for this theoretical framework and perspective analysis, as it represents a conceptual synthesis of existing literature and policy frameworks rather than primary research involving human participants. This manuscript establishes a theoretical foundation and an implementation framework for AI-driven healthcare democratization, grounded in published evidence and established models of healthcare access. The work focuses on guiding healthcare policymakers and planning professionals rather than collecting new data from patients or the public. However, the framework explicitly emphasizes the critical importance of patient advocacy organizations and community representation in AI development processes, recognizing that meaningful patient involvement will be essential during the actual implementation phases of AI healthcare technologies described in this theoretical foundation.
